Ronaldinho names three players better than Lionel Messi

Ex-Barcelona star Ronaldinho has given his thought on who the Greatest player of all time is and it won’t go down well with many Blaugrana faithful.

Ronaldinho spent five seasons at Camp Nou where he won the FIFA World Player of the Year as well as the Ballon d’Or among other top individual honours.

The 39-year-old was also teammates with six-time Ballon d’Or winner Lionel Messi and has rated the Argentine as the best player of his era, but not the greatest of all time.

Speaking with Spanish media outlet, Marca, per football-italia.net, the 2002 FIFA World Cup winner said, “I’m glad Messi won the Ballon d’Or.

“We were also friends during our time at Barcelona.

“But I don’t like to compare, and I find it difficult to say he is the best of all time.”

The former Brazil international named three players whom he rated above the Barcelona captain in the GOAT debate.

“There were [Diego] Maradona, Pele, Ronaldo… it’s hard to say that Messi is the best throughout the history of football. I can say he is the best of his era.”
